Linda and Jennings Spears Among Three Charged in Logan County Drug Bust

Three individuals from Amherstdale, West Virginia, are facing serious drug charges following a significant seizure in Logan County. On Wednesday, West Virginia State Police arrested Linda Spears, Jennings Spears, and Rickey Browning during a raid that uncovered a substantial cache of illegal substances and cash.

Authorities reported seizing approximately 23 pounds of marijuana, 50 grams of fentanyl, five suboxone pills, and around $14,000 in cash during the operation. The arrests were made in the Amherstdale area after troopers conducted a drug investigation targeting narcotics distribution.

Linda and Jennings Spears were each charged with possession with intent to deliver fentanyl and suboxone. Rickey Browning was charged with possession with intent to deliver marijuana.

The investigation is ongoing, and the suspects await further court proceedings as law enforcement continues its crackdown on drug activity in the region.
